Transaction 95415fed49c356c6675bc5bd0d572238076c1644a89ecea67cbf0481af89e88d
1 Input
1 Output
-
95415fed49c356c6675bc5bd0d572238076c1644a89ecea67cbf0481af89e88d:0
- value
- 72164
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 af2aeeed801bf835ef0c7a3842b75fc6e06d60a6 OP_EQUAL
- address
- 3HfDcAyjfvge5eoQLaDUan2tQDqWto24fS